For the purpose of ir applications in linguistic morphology, stemming is the process for reducing inflected (or sometimes derived) porter stemming algorithm 3 krovetz stemming algorithm and 4 dawson stemming algorithm 23 lemmatization algorithms. David sanz morales maximum power point tracking algorithms for photovoltaic applications faculty of electronics, communications and automation thesis submitted for examination for the degree of master of science in technology. Implement from scratch using the porter stemming algorithm (or port someone elses implementation to c#) eg: once i got their way of doing things, it was straight forward to use the porter stemmer (also very little code) edited by claudiuavram saturday, august 29, 2015 12:13 am. However, stemmers are typically easier to implement and run faster, and the reduced accuracy may not matter for some applications how to use stemmer in nltk which is based on the porter stemming algorithm part iv: stemming and lemmatization 7 comments. The paper describes a word stemming algorithm for the spanish language experiments in document retrieval regarding english text suggest that word stemming based on morphological analysis does not generally or it is difficult to produce a porter style algorithm for a romantic. Unit tests for snowball stemmer from nltkstemsnowball import snowballstemmer see which languages are supported print( join(snowballstemmerlanguages)) danish dutch english finnish french german hungarian italian norwegian porter portuguese romanian russian spanish swedish.
Using of porter stremmer algorithm overview the porter stemmer is a conflation stemmer developed by martin porter at the university of cambridge in 1980. 34 how-to-do: stopword removal and stemming learners will be able to develop interesting text mining applications from the lesson text analysis techniques it simply implements porter stemmer algorithm in java. There is a growing interest in the use of context-awareness as a technique for developing pervasive computing applications that are flexible and adaptable for users in this context, however, information retrieval context-aware stemming algorithm for semantically related root words. The porter stemming algorithm this page was completely revised jan 2006 the earlier edition is here this is the 'official' home page for distribution of the porter stemming algorithm, written and maintained by its author, martin porter. Evaluation of a dutch stemming algorithm wessel kraaij and renee pohlmann we have chosen to modify the stemming algorithm developed by porter porter reports a reduction of about a third in vocabulary size after application of his stemmer to a vocabulary of 10000 different word forms.
Common error in stemming v describes applications of stemmer vi presents the conclusion first author name: dhabal prasad sethi this algorithm is developed by martin porter in 1980now this algorithm is widely used in different language 3. Evaluation of a dutch stemming algorithm we have chosen to modify the stemming algorithm developed by porter porter reports a reduction of about a third in vocabulary size after application of his stemmer to a vocabulary of 10000 different word forms. 140 implementation of porter's modified stemming algorithm in an indonesian word error detection plugin application the validity of each word in a document written in the indonesian language in order to eliminate. Developing a word stemming program using porters algorithm - powerpoint removing some endings of word computer compute computes computing computed computation comput porter algorithm (porter very dumb rules work well (for english) porter stemmer: iteratively remove suffixes. Topic- stemming technology subject considered as equivalent for the purpose of ir applications it is in this light that, a number of so-called stemming algorithms language (with significant use of the porter stemmer algorithm). Nltkstemporter module porter stemmer this is the porter stemming algorithm it follows the algorithm presented in porter, m a word stemmer based on the porter stemming algorithm porter, m an algorithm for suffix stripping.
A detailed analysis of english stemming algorithms david a hull gregory grefenstette applications therefore, stemming or conflation algorithms have been created for jr the lovins stemmer  and the porter stemmer , are based on suffix removal.
The primary use of stemming words is in keyword indexing, if you're building a search application php class: porter stemming algorithm the porter stemming algorithm was developed by martin porter for reducing english words to their word stems. I need to create simple search engine for my application let's simplify it to the following: we have some texts (a lot) and i need to search and show relevant results i've based on this great a. Application lifecycle running a business sales / marketing collaboration / beta testing i have this porter algorithm code in c#,can someone tell me how to save the output of this code to txt file also do i input name of a file or w = new char stemmer s = new stemmer. Many modifications and enhancements have been done and suggested on the basis of the porter stemmer algorithm in order is generated in step 3 from the application word and is stemmed stemming algorithm for efficient information retrieval systems and web search engines.
Application of porter stremmer algorithm essay using of porter stremmer algorithm overview the porter stemmer is a conflation stemmer developed by martin porter at the university of cambridge in 1980 the stemmer is a context sensitive suffix removal algorithm. Video created by yonsei university for the course hands-on text mining and analytics learners will be able to develop interesting text mining applications from the lesson a popular stemming algorithm for english is porter algorithm. Porter's stemming algorithm for dutch wessel kraaij and ren ee pohlmann the paper describes the development of a dutch version of the porter stemming algorithm the the final cluster contains rules that tidy up the result of previous rule applications eg v. Although the lovins stemmer is the oldest stemmer by far , i'd say that martin porter's porter stemming  algorithm is by far the most popular one (ie what is the most popular stemming algorithms in text classification update cancel promoted by text classification applications.